Thorn Baker Recruitment is seeking a Resourcing Consultant for its Construction team in Leeds. This role focuses on helping clients find the best construction talent without the pressure of cold sales.
The position offers a basic salary of £27,500 with realistic OTE between £32k and £36k, structured training, and a supportive work environment.
The ideal candidate will be confident, organised, and enjoy engaging with people, with an opportunity to develop a long-term recruitment career.

How to prepare for a job interview at Thorn Baker Recruitment
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and the construction industry and the specific role of a Resourcing Consultant. Research Thorn Baker Recruitment and their values, so you can show how you align with their mission and culture.
✨Show Off Your People Skills
Since this role involves engaging with clients and candidates, be prepared to demonstrate your communication skills. Think of examples where you've successfully built relationships or resolved conflicts, as this will highlight your ability to connect with people.
✨Be Organised
As a Construction Resourcer, organisation is key. Bring a notepad or device to jot down important points during the interview. This shows you're proactive and ready to manage multiple tasks, which is crucial in recruitment.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company and the role.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you. Ask about their training programmes and growth opportunities to demonstrate your eagerness to develop a long-term career.
